Description | Hear about the history of Wardsend Cemetery which has stood on its site by the River Don for the last 160 years. This cemetery is the last resting place of over 30,000 Sheffield and district people as well as military personnel from the nearby Sheffield (Hillsborough) Barracks. In the course of more than a century and a half, a wide variety of flora and fauna have also begun to call the cemetery home. Thebluebells should be in full bloom |
